PB Cup Protein Ice Cream
•1 vanilla protein milk
•2 tablespoons of peanut butter powder
•1 tablespoon of white choc pudding mix
•2 skinny pb cups, chopped (ad-in)
Whisk the milk, pb powder, and pudding mix together in the container. Freeze 24 hours. Mix with CREAMi machine setting “light ice cream”, add the chopped peanut butter cups, and mix again with “mix-in” setting.

Strawberry Ice Cream
•3 strawberries, mashed
•1/3 cup sugar or granulated monk fruit
•1 tablespoon cream cheese, melted
•3/4 cup heavy whipping cream
•3/4 cup whole milk
•splash vanilla extract
Mix all in the container and freeze for 24 hrs. Use the CREAMi setting “ice cream” to mix.

Banana Pineapple Sorbet
•3 bananas sliced thin
•1/2 a can of pineapples, chopped, drained
Mash the bananas and pineapples in the container. Freeze 24 hours. Mix on the Creami “sorbet” setting, Add a bit of the juice from the can or water if powdery, Remix. Enjoy smooth sorbet.

    Has anybody made the ice cream with a bottle of fair life chocolate protein shake? We got a new machine and we made vanilla ice cream and it was delicious. Then we tried the protein which I’ve seen people do on TikTok and they just use the bottle of shake mix with nothing else, but ours would only mix halfway down the mixture and it was very dry so we added a couple tablespoons of shake mix, and it was still very dry and chunky and only mixed the top half of the mixture.

    • Trish (Hip Sidekick)

      Hi there, Gramma C! I did some searching online and found a few tips if these might be helpful when making ice cream using the fair life protein shake. ❤️ –
      -Consider adding things like pudding mix, peanut butter, cocoa powder, or extracts for extra flavor and creaminess.
      -Place the frozen pint in the Ninja Creami and select the “milkshake” or “lite ice cream” setting for a soft-serve consistency.
      -You can respin the mixture to achieve an even creamier texture.
      -Ensure the mixture is fully frozen before spinning it in the Ninja Creami for the best results.
